Fintech lender KreditBee raises Rs 60 crore from SIDBI’s India SME

Mumbai: KreditBee has raised Rs 60 crore (about $8 million) in equity and debt from SIDBI’s investment arm—India SME Investments, the fintech lender said.

The funding is part of its Series C round, in which the startup earlier this year raised about $145 million from the likes of Premji Invest, Mirae Asset Ventures, TPG-backed NewQuest Capital Partners and Motilal Oswal Private Equity. India SME invested Rs 28.4 crore in September 2019 as debt in Krazybee Services, the holding company of KreditBee.
